Method of studying corrosive effects of hot gases - involves subjecting half of a split bush to the gas flow

Themethod is for firearm bores corroded and eroded by gases resulting from powder combustion. An erosion bush is formed by joining together two pieces of identical geometry. The one piece is flat while the other piece has an erosion channel. Typically for a 20mm bore gun, the erosion bush has length of 40mm and the channel has depth of 0.3mm and width of 1.6mm. The bush is submitted to the action of gas which flows through channel in a manometric bomb possessing stopper plugs ensuring gas tightness, the two halves being held firmly in contact by a solid component of the bomb. The contact face of the first piece is then studied with a scanning electron microscope of a Castaing microprobe.
